<?php
/*
* @copyright Copyright (C) 2010-2024 Combodo SAS
* @license http://opensource.org/licenses/AGPL-3.0
*/
namespace Combodo\iTop\Core\AttributeDefinition;
use CMDBSource;
use CoreException;
use utils;
/**
* Map a decimal value column (suitable for financial computations) to an attribute
* internally in PHP such numbers are represented as string. Should you want to perform
* a calculation on them, it is recommended to use the BC Math functions in order to
* retain the precision
*
* @package iTopORM
*/
class AttributeDecimal extends AttributeDBField
{
public const SEARCH_WIDGET_TYPE = self::SEARCH_WIDGET_TYPE_NUMERIC;
/**
* Useless constructor, but if not present PHP 7.4.0/7.4.1 is crashing :( (N°2329)
*
* @see https://www.php.net/manual/fr/language.oop5.decon.php states that child constructor can be ommited
* @see https://bugs.php.net/bug.php?id=79010 bug solved in PHP 7.4.9
*
* @param string $sCode
* @param array $aParams
*
* @throws Exception
* @noinspection SenselessProxyMethodInspection
*/
public function __construct($sCode, $aParams)
{
parent::__construct($sCode, $aParams);
}
public static function ListExpectedParams()
{
return array_merge(parent::ListExpectedParams(), ['digits', 'decimals' /* including precision */]);
}
public function GetEditClass()
{
return "String";
}
protected function GetSQLCol($bFullSpec = false)
{
return "DECIMAL(".$this->Get('digits').",".$this->Get('decimals').")".($bFullSpec ? $this->GetSQLColSpec() : '');
}
public function GetValidationPattern()
{
$iNbDigits = $this->Get('digits');
$iPrecision = $this->Get('decimals');
$iNbIntegerDigits = $iNbDigits - $iPrecision;
return "^[\-\+]?\d{1,$iNbIntegerDigits}(\.\d{0,$iPrecision})?$";
}
/**
* @inheritDoc
* @since 3.2.0
*/
public function CheckFormat($value)
{
$sRegExp = $this->GetValidationPattern();
return preg_match("/$sRegExp/", $value);
}
public function GetBasicFilterOperators()
{
return [
"!=" => "differs from",
"=" => "equals",
">" => "greater (strict) than",
">=" => "greater than",
"<" => "less (strict) than",
"<=" => "less than",
"in" => "in",
];
}
public function GetBasicFilterLooseOperator()
{
// Unless we implement an "equals approximately..." or "same order of magnitude"
return "=";
}
public function GetBasicFilterSQLExpr($sOpCode, $value)
{
$sQValue = CMDBSource::Quote($value);
switch ($sOpCode) {
case '!=':
return $this->GetSQLExpr()." != $sQValue";
break;
case '>':
return $this->GetSQLExpr()." > $sQValue";
break;
case '>=':
return $this->GetSQLExpr()." >= $sQValue";
break;
case '<':
return $this->GetSQLExpr()." < $sQValue";
break;
case '<=':
return $this->GetSQLExpr()." <= $sQValue";
break;
case 'in':
if (!is_array($value)) {
throw new CoreException("Expected an array for argument value (sOpCode='$sOpCode')");
}
return $this->GetSQLExpr()." IN ('".implode("', '", $value)."')";
break;
case '=':
default:
return $this->GetSQLExpr()." = \"$value\"";
}
}
public function GetNullValue()
{
return null;
}
public function IsNull($proposedValue)
{
return is_null($proposedValue);
}
/**
* @inheritDoc
*/
public function HasAValue($proposedValue): bool
{
return utils::IsNotNullOrEmptyString($proposedValue);
}
public function MakeRealValue($proposedValue, $oHostObj)
{
if (is_null($proposedValue)) {
return null;
}
if ($proposedValue === '') {
return null;
}
return $this->ScalarToSQL($proposedValue);
}
public function ScalarToSQL($value)
{
assert(is_null($value) || preg_match('/'.$this->GetValidationPattern().'/', $value));
if (!is_null($value) && ($value !== '')) {
$value = sprintf("%1.".$this->Get('decimals')."F", $value);
}
return $value; // null or string
}
}
